Garud Vahini Vaishnavi Launched
3/27/2023 10:44:01 PM
Early Times Report

Jammu, Mar 27: With holy blessings of ee Mata Vaishno Devi Ji, a powerful bhajan video, sung by Hira Lal Abrol, Chairman- Healthy India Stronger India (NGO) for invocation of the combined energies of Mata Mahakali, Mahalakshmi and Mahasaraswati was launched today. The video with wordings - ‘Garud Vahini Vaishnavi, Trikuta Parvat Dham, Kaali, Lakshmi, Saraswati, kti Tumhain Pranaam’ was shot at famous religious locations of Jammu & Katra. The holy temples that featured in this video are: Kol Kandoli Mata Nagrota,ee Sai Dham Gandhi Nagar, Mahalakshmi Temple Pacca Danga, Mata Kali Temple Sarwal, Bawe Wali Mata & Mahamaya Mata Temple Jammu, Nau Devi Mandir and Temples enroute to ee Mata Vaishno Devi Ji Holy Bhawan Katra.

This is the second video that has been sung by Hira Lal Abrol, the first one was the ‘Ram Chalisa Video’ that was shot inside the holy premises of ee Raghunath Ji Temple Jammu. This video was widely appreciated by religious followers and the members of civil society. Healthy India, Stronger India is an NGO founded by Chairman, Hira Lal Abrol. This NGO is running a ‘Free Training Centre’ for skill development of needy and poor children from BPL families. The training center offers 3 months, free courses in Basic Computers; Cutting & Tailoring Classes; Beautician Course, Vocal Music, Dance as well as Free Library for the students. Nearly 5000 students have passed out, after successful completion of courses from this Centre and enjoy.
